At present, there are no direct flights from Banjul to Monastir.
However, there are several flights from BJL to MIR with a stopover.
Select a stopover airport from the list below to see which airlines operate flights from BJL to MIR, and to see what flight schedules are available.
Currently, there is only one airline that covers the full route (with 1 stopover) from Banjul BJL to Monastir MIR, which is Brussels Airlines.
All other flights from Banjul to Monastir are operated by a combination of multiple carriers, which are listed below:
Star Alliance is the only alliance that covers the full route (with 1 stopover) from Banjul BJL to Monastir MIR.
You can fly the full journey from BJL to MIR in either Economy or Business Class. Premium Economy and First Class are not available on this route, at least not on the full route with just 1 stopover.
However, for the first part of this route, Economy, Premium Economy and Business Class are available. This depends on the stopover airport of your choice though.
Again depending on your stopover airport, available classes for the second part of this route are Economy and Business Class.
At this moment, it is not possible to cover the full route from Banjul to Monastir (with 1 stopover) with one specific type of aircraft. All flights from Banjul to Monastir are operated by a combination of multiple aircraft types.
The distance between Banjul and Monastir is 2,304 miles (3,707 kilometers).
However, because there are no direct flights between BJL and MIR, the distance of the full journey varies between 3,942 and 3,896 miles (or 6,344 and 6,270 kilometers), depending on your stopover airport.
Flights from Banjul to Monastir take from 8 hours and 45 minutes up to 8 hours and 50 minutes, depending on your stopover airport.
Please note that these times refer to the actual flight times, excluding the stopover time in between connecting flights, as this depends on your stopover airport as well as your date(s) of travel.
